BYD触摸芯片编程入门指南
简介
BYD是一家知名的电子公司,其产品涵盖了多个领域,包括电动汽车、电池、太阳能和智能硬件等。在智能硬件领域,BYD触摸芯片是一项重要的技术,它被广泛应用于智能手机、平板电脑、智能家居等产品中。本教程旨在介绍BYD触摸芯片的编程方法和基本原理,帮助初学者快速入门。
1. BYD触摸芯片简介
BYD触摸芯片是一种集成了触摸控制功能的芯片,它能够感知人体的触摸操作,并将其转化为电信号。通过编程,可以实现触摸芯片在不同应用场景下的功能,例如触摸屏幕的手势识别、按钮控制等。
2. 准备工作
在开始编程之前,需要准备以下工作:
BYD触摸芯片开发板:可以通过BYD官方渠道或者第三方渠道购买到。
开发环境:通常使用C语言或者特定的集成开发环境(IDE)进行编程。
USB连接线:用于将开发板连接到计算机上。
3. 编程步骤
以下是使用C语言编程BYD触摸芯片的基本步骤:
步骤1:
设置开发环境。确保已经安装好了所需的开发环境,并将BYD触摸芯片开发板连接到计算机上。步骤2:
创建新项目。在IDE中创建一个新的项目,并选择适当的芯片型号和开发板。步骤3:
编写代码。使用C语言编写程序代码,实现对触摸芯片的控制和功能定义。这可能涉及到配置触摸芯片的参数、处理触摸事件等。步骤4:
编译代码。将编写好的代码编译成可执行文件,以便在触摸芯片开发板上运行。步骤5:
烧录程序。将编译生成的可执行文件烧录到触摸芯片开发板中。步骤6:
测试功能。连接开发板到电源,测试程序是否能够正常运行,并验证触摸功能是否按预期工作。4. 注意事项
在编程BYD触摸芯片时,需要注意以下事项:
了解触摸芯片的技术规格和功能特性,以便正确地编写代码。
注意触摸芯片与其他硬件组件的连接方式和通信协议。
对于初学者,建议先从简单的示例程序开始,逐步增加复杂度。
在编程过程中,及时保存代码并进行版本管理,以防止意外丢失。
5. 示例代码

以下是一个简单的示例代码,演示了如何配置BYD触摸芯片的基本参数和处理触摸事件:
```c
include
int main() {
// 初始化触摸芯片
byd_touch_init();
// 配置触摸灵敏度
byd_touch_set_sensitivity(50);
// 循环监听触摸事件
while(1) {
if(byd_touch_is_touched()) {
// 如果有触摸事件发生,执行相应操作
int touch_position = byd_touch_get_position();
// 根据触摸位置执行相应操作
switch(touch_position) {
case 1:
// 执行操作1
break;
case 2:
// 执行操作2
break;
// 其他触摸位置的处理
}
}
}
return 0;
}
```
结论
通过本教程,你应该对如何编程BYD触摸芯片有了基本的了解。要深入掌握这一技术,建议你阅读更多相关的文档和教程,同时不断实践和尝试。祝你在BYD触摸芯片编程的路上取得成功!
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。








